SDL Where The Vaccum Lines Should BE Conected Inside

SDL 1987 I have A vacuum Line the Comes from the little Filter near the Turbo Area that is attach to the inside of the Car but I do not Know where should be attach. Now is not conected to anything. The Other came from the Inside and goes to side of the Injection Pump under the ALDA. Does any body have a good diagram of an SDL of the Vacuums lines and Where should the hose should be connected on the inside. Thanks

That hose dos not connect to anything,its where air gets sucked into the system and was put thru into the inside of the car because the air there is likely to be cleaner than under the hood,those germans thought of everything. Don
